When my companion and I arrived they had not been open very long so there were few customers. We we greeted courteously and immediately after entering. Our plan was for lunch to be the main meal of the day.We were brought chips and salsa and our drink orders delivered quickly. The chips were fresh and the salsa delicious with a tangy taste I liked.I ordered a meal plate that included an enchilada, burrito, tostada, (beef was my meat choice) Mexican rice and refried beans. Everything I ate was beyond delicious. The food was very hot when it was brought to us. The portions were humongous, to the point of beyond generous. I've been looking for good Mexican food, and have found my new favorite Mexican restaurant.The restaurant is older but was very clean. The restrooms were clean. The seating was organized without crowding. There is a bar and an outside patio for use when the weather permits.

I'm from South Texas. So the food here was respectable, considering I was eating Mexican food in Maine. I enjoyed it. Could have used a little more seasoning, but all in all, it's pretty good. Guacamole was really good and fresh. Chips and salsa seemed store bought, as well as the corn tortillas. Fresh chips, fresh salsa, and homemade corn tortillas would send this place over the top. Staff was courteous and attentive.
